How much do pos eng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 7, 2026, the average yearly pay for pos engineer in Ohio is $96,736.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$79,900.00 and $110,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a POS engineer?

A POS (Point of Sale) Engineer is responsible for developing, maintaining, and troubleshooting point-of-sale systems used in retail and hospitality industries. They configure hardware and software solutions, ensure system security, and integrate payment processing technologies. POS Engineers also provide technical support, optimize system performance, and implement updates to enhance functionality and reliability. Their role is crucial for ensuring seamless transaction processing and a smooth customer experience.

What are some common challenges a POS engineer faces during a typical workweek?

A POS Engineer often encounters challenges such as troubleshooting complex hardware or software issues, ensuring compatibility between various devices, and minimizing downtime during system upgrades or installations. They may need to respond quickly to urgent service requests or work outside regular business hours to implement updates without disrupting daily operations. Effective collaboration with IT, operations, and vendor teams is crucial for resolving issues efficiently. Being proactive in preventative maintenance and staying updated on the latest POS technologies also helps reduce recurring problems and supports smooth business operations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a POS engineer?

To excel as a POS (Point of Sale) Engineer, you need a strong background in computer science, electronics, or a related field, along with experience in deploying and maintaining POS hardware and software systems. Familiarity with POS platforms (such as NCR, Oracle Micros, or Toshiba), networking fundamentals, and relevant certifications like CompTIA A+ or vendor-specific credentials are often required. Problem-solving skills, effective communication, and the ability to work collaboratively are valuable soft skills in this role. These competencies ensure smooth implementation and ongoing reliability of POS systems, which are critical for business operations in retail and hospitality environments.

Job description

Data Center & Route Switch Field Service Technician :

This is a full time benefits eligible position that includes a company vehicle, gas card for vehicle, inventory, and training. Paid training including Router, Switch, Rack and Stack and Structured Cabling among other topics. If you are technical, Acuative is willing to invest in you for this role.

This position requires a person willing to go to new places. Tickets can be assigned four or more hours away to provide installation and maintenance services to voice and data networks, servers, computer systems, retail technology systems, and other network-based hardware.

Acuative technicians are guaranteed forty (40) hours of pay per week even if not dispatched for forty hours.

To be eligible for this role you must have a clear driver’s license (no more than 4 points), have the Covid-19 vaccination, and willing to work mostly M-F with opportunity for overtime and call out pay after hours. This position often works alone, and qualified applicants must be able to lift up to fifty pounds above head and climb a ladder.

Selected candidates are given paid training and support as needed for every job they are routed to.

Acuative is a drug free workplace.

Overview :

Acuative, the nation's leading independent provider of telecommunications field services, seeks a Field Service Technician. The successful candidate will spend the majority of their time covering the (MARKET) area providing installation and maintenance services to voice and data networks, servers, computer systems, retail technology systems, and other network based hardware.

Primary Duties and Responsibilities :

The position involves a variety of tasks including but not limited to:

  • Installation and maintenance of networking hardware including routers, switches, and WAP’s.
  • Installation and maintenance of telephony equipment and circuits.
  • Installation and support of retail technology systems – POS, Digital Signage, and Video Surveillance Systems.
  • Circuit extensions and structured cabling.
  • Site surveys and site audits.
  • Installation of LEO (Low Earth Orbit) satellite receivers, cables and hardware.
  • Installation of Fixed Wireless Antennas, cables and hardware.
  • Accurate and timely submission of all job-related documents and deliverables.
  • Maintain company vehicle, inventory, and tools to departmental standards.

Preferred Qualifications :

Candidates should possess many of the following KSAs:

  • Working knowledge of networking hardware and topologies.
  • Familiarity with Cisco networking products and interfacing through Cisco CLI.
  • Understanding of telephony systems (VOIP, PBX, Key Systems) with an ability to provide hands-on hardware and troubleshooting support.
  • Knowledge of computing systems hardware with the ability to provide break/fix support for desktop PC and/or servers.
  • Physical installations of a wide variety of hardware including routers, switches, WAPs, servers, POS systems, digital signage systems, and associated peripheral equipment.
  • Ability to provide configuration support for a variety of technology platforms through console and remote applications.
  • Experience with LEC circuit identification and extensions.
  • Familiarity with cabling standards and the ability to pull and terminate cabling in a variety of customer environments.
  • Ability to operate basic power tools – drills, saws, etc.
  • Work on ladders and lifts where required.
  • Working knowledge of Microsoft Office applications (Excel & Word).
  • Ability to follow detailed job documents.
  • Must be willing to travel as needed to meet customer SLAs.
  • On-call, after hours, and weekend work may be required.
  • Must possess a valid drivers’ license with good driving record.
  • Experience installing LEO Satellite (such as Starlink) and/or Fixed Wireless antennas.

Education & Certifications :

  • Associates degree in Information Technology or equivalent experience.
  • CompTIA, Cisco, Cabling, and PBX system certifications a plus!
  • Selected candidates will be required to attend a hardware and cabling training course at our Global Technology Center in Strongsville, OH.
